Submission of Hannam 2 District Building Review... Hannam New Town Heating Up with the 'Hannam 3 District Effect' View original image


[Asia Economy Reporter Donghyun Choi] With Hyundai Engineering & Construction selected as the contractor for the redevelopment project of Hannam 3 District in Yongsan-gu, Seoul, enthusiasm is heating up for the surrounding Districts 2, 4, and 5. Construction companies such as GS Engineering & Construction and Daelim Industrial, which missed out on the Hannam 3 District redevelopment project, are expected to put their all into securing construction rights for Hannam New Town.


According to the maintenance industry on the 24th, among Hannam Districts 2, 4, and 5, the district expected to be promoted first after District 3 is District 2. In fact, the Hannam 2 District redevelopment association recently submitted a building review plan to Yongsan-gu Office. This comes eight years after the association was approved for establishment on June 1, 2012. The building review is a crucial procedure before obtaining permits when constructing buildings above a certain scale, assessing urban aesthetics and public interest, and is the most important step before receiving project implementation approval after the association’s establishment.


Hannam 2 District covers 115,005㎡ around 271-3 Bogwang-dong and plans to build 1,537 apartment units through redevelopment. The project’s pace is the second fastest in Hannam New Town after Hannam 3 District. Recently, domestic construction companies that participated in the Hannam 3 District bidding revealed preliminary development plans including specialized designs, which has encouraged the Hannam 2 District project to accelerate. A member of the Hannam 2 District association said, "Recently, construction company employees have been frequently visiting Hannam New Town, and residents are being stimulated by advertising leaflets containing development blueprints," adding, "Hannam 2 District is close to Itaewon Station and has excellent access to Yongsan Park, so once development is complete, it will be the most notable location."


Another reason accelerating the Hannam 2 District project is to avoid the upcoming rule, effective in September, that mandates a maximum 30% supply ratio of rental housing in redevelopment projects. To avoid this rule included in the amendment to the Enforcement Decree of the Act on Maintenance and Improvement of Urban Areas and Dwelling Conditions, which passed the Cabinet meeting on the 16th, the project must receive implementation approval or submit an application by the end of August. However, the association believes it is unlikely to avoid this regulation due to time constraints. A Hannam 2 District association official explained, "We submitted a building review plan reflecting Seoul City’s opinions as much as possible, but we do not know if it will pass immediately," adding, "Whether the regulation can be avoided is beyond the association’s control."


Hannam 4 District is the largest in terms of household scale among the remaining Hannam New Town projects. It covers 119,510㎡ around 360 Bogwang-dong and is planned to be redeveloped into 2,595 apartment units. The association was established in January 2015, and in November 2018, it submitted a redevelopment promotion plan amendment to Seoul City and is awaiting approval. The project gained momentum after deciding to demolish the recently controversial Shindonga Apartments. Currently, the association president position is vacant, and efforts are underway to form the association’s executive body by recruiting election management committee members. A representative from a real estate agency in Bogwang-dong said, "Compared to other districts, District 4 has almost no share splitting and fewer association members, so it has the largest general sale volume," adding, "The investment profitability is good, so the project progress should not be a problem."


Hannam 5 District is currently preparing an amendment to the redevelopment promotion plan, which is expected to accelerate the project. This site covers 186,781㎡ around 60 Dongbinggo-dong and plans for 2,359 apartment units. Since Hannam 4 and 5 Districts are adjacent, Seoul City plans to announce the approval of the redevelopment promotion plan amendment in a way that enhances the connectivity between the two districts, working with public architects.



The maintenance industry expects that redevelopment projects in Hannam New Town’s Districts 2, 4, and 5 will attract many construction companies to bid due to their excellent location and profitability. As redevelopment sites are decreasing due to government regulations, securing the large-scale Hannam New Town redevelopment rights is likely to change the landscape of redevelopment projects. An industry insider said, "Hyundai Engineering & Construction, which won the contract for Hannam 3 District, is aiming for additional contracts in this area," adding, "GS Engineering & Construction, Daelim Industrial, Daewoo Engineering & Construction, and Lotte Engineering & Construction are also preparing to secure project rights."
